Inventors

Original assignee

The original assignee, as named on the issued patent and confirmed by early assignment records, is Neurent Medical Limited. Neurent Medical Limited develops and commercializes medical devices for chronic rhinitis, such as the NEUROMARK® System, which aligns with the claims of US 12096973 for therapeutic nasal treatment using a handheld device. The company appears to be currently operating, as indicated by the recent granting of a security interest, suggesting ongoing business activities.

NPE / troll-pattern signals

  1. Shell-entity transfernot present. The patent was assigned from the inventor to an operating company (Neurent Medical Limited), and a subsequent record is a security interest, not a transfer of title to a licensing-only entity.
  2. Known asserter in the chainnot present. Neither Neurent Medical Limited nor CLARET EUROPEAN SPECIALTY LENDING COMPANY III, S.A R.L. are listed as known patent asserters or NPEs.
  3. Repeat correspondent across the chainnot present. The two recorded events have different correspondents: KILPATRICK TOWNSEND & STOCKTON LLP and ROPES & GRAY LLP.
  4. Cascading transfersnot present. There are only two recorded events, one being an inventor assignment and the other a security interest, neither of which indicates rapid consecutive assignments through shell LLCs.
  5. Pre-litigation transfernot present. The inventor assignment (transfer of title) was executed on 2024-06-25, approximately three months before the first infringement suit was filed on 2024-09-24. The security interest was granted after the litigation commenced.
  6. Bankruptcy fire-salenot present. There is no indication of Neurent Medical Limited being in bankruptcy.
  7. Privateeringnot present. The current assignee, Neurent Medical Limited, is an operating company that appears to be asserting its own intellectual property.
  8. Defensive aggregator (anti-NPE)not present. The chain does not terminate at a known defensive aggregator.

Verdict

Operating-company assertion
This verdict is based on the initial assignment from the inventor to Neurent Medical Limited on 2024-06-25 (Reel 063688/0101). Neurent Medical Limited is an operating company that develops and sells medical devices, which embody the claims of the patent. The subsequent record is a security interest (Reel 063852/0126), not a transfer of title for assertion purposes, and there are no other signals indicating an NPE pattern.
